About the Program

The Master in Global Development is a one-year program for students who want to help people in developing countries. It's a Master's degree taught in English at the University of East Anglia in the United Kingdom.

This program teaches students about global development, including poverty, inequality, and environmental issues. Students learn skills like research, analysis, and project management, and they get to work on real projects to help them learn.

Graduates of this program can work as Development Managers, Policy Analysts, Humanitarian Workers, or Sustainability Consultants. They can work for organizations like the United Nations, non-profits, or government agencies.
